Beauchamp Students Win The Voice Kids

Two Year 7 students from Beauchamp College recently triumphed on The Voice Kids.

Andrea and Shanice, the 11-year-old ‘Wonder Twins,’ were crowned winners of the show’s seventh series on Saturday evening after a tight, closely-fought final.

Based on the mainstream show with the same name, The Voice Kids is a national competition for children aged seven to 14 and aims to find the best young singer in the UK.

In their blind initial audition, the girls left the audience and the four judges – Pixie Lott, Ronan Keating, Will.I.Am and Danny Jones – spellbound with a stunning cover of 'Faith' by Stevie Wonder and Ariana Grande.

The energetic and passionate performance resulted in three of judges turning around, with the girls choosing former member of the Black Eyed Peas, Will to be their mentor.

Having shone in their initial audition, Andrea and Shanice, who formerly attended Brock Hill Primary School, then took to the stage again on Saturday night, competing against other hopefuls in the showpiece final.

To kick off the final, the twins performed Lizzo’s ‘Special’ as part of ‘Team Will’s’ battle segment – where all of Will’s acts performed together. The girls were then selected as part of the final four.

Taking on the Coldplay classic ‘Sky Full of Stars,’ Andrea and Shanice managed to top their initial audition, delivering a hugely poignant performance that saw host Emma Willis announce them as overall winners.

As a reward for being crowned The Voice Kids Champion, the girls received a special family holiday to Universal Orlando Resort in Florida.
